Output 8664083140065bb661477be7e794e3702a974788f5ab44720b3e2ccc86ac3aa7:18

value
19122816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9377b684066970e36f1b90f722355af149f5e7b8 OP_EQUAL
address
3F8kfYY8jAS3d9KMAJBuqVbwU1xmp5u3bM
transaction
8664083140065bb661477be7e794e3702a974788f5ab44720b3e2ccc86ac3aa7
spent
true